Inside the age of big data along with artificial intelligence, the synergy between applied mathematics and even machine learning has never really been more pronounced. Machine understanding algorithms, which power anything from recommendation systems to independent vehicles, rely heavily about mathematical foundations to function efficiently. In this article, we explore the particular critical role of applied mathematics in enhancing equipment learning algorithms, shedding gentle on the mathematical techniques that will drive innovation in this domain.
The Mathematical Pillars for Machine Learning
Machine understanding encompasses a variety of algorithms, however , several mathematical concepts application form its core:
Linear Algebra: Linear algebra is the bedrock of machine learning. Matrices and vectors are used to symbolise data, and operations just like matrix multiplication and eigenvalue decomposition underpin various rules. Principal Component Analysis (PCA) and Singular Value Decomposition (SVD) are notable versions of.
Calculus: Calculus provides the system for optimization, a key component of machine learning. Gradient nice, a calculus-based technique, must be used to minimize loss functions as well as train models efficiently.
Opportunity and Statistics: Probability principle and statistics are core to understanding uncertainty and even modeling randomness in data files. Bayesian methods, maximum chances estimation, and hypothesis testing are widely applied.
Information Theory: Information theory may help quantify the amount of information in data, which is crucial for feature selection and dimensionality reduction. The concept of entropy is frequently used in decision trees plus random forests.
Differential Equations: Differential equations are used around models that involve adjust over time, such as in periodic neural networks (RNNs) plus time series forecasting.
Strengthening Machine Learning through Put on Mathematics
Feature Engineering: Placed mathematics aids in feature assortment and extraction. Techniques for instance Principal Component Analysis (PCA) and t-SNE use math principles to reduce high-dimensional data into meaningful lower-dimensional illustrations.
Optimization Algorithms: Machine knowing models are trained by way of optimization techniques, with calculus serving as the foundation. Numerical optimization methods, such as stochastic gradient descent (SGD) and even Adam, allow models to be able to converge to optimal ranges efficiently.
Regularization Techniques: L1 and L2 regularization on linear regression and nerve organs networks prevent overfitting by making use of mathematical penalties to the model’s complexity.
Kernel Methods: Nucleus methods, rooted in thready algebra and functional analysis, transform data into higher-dimensional spaces, enhancing the separability of data points. Support Vector Machines (SVM) use this statistical technique for classification.
Markov Products: Markov models, based on opportunity theory, are used in organic language processing and language recognition. Hidden Markov Styles (HMMs) are particularly influential in these domains.
Graph Theory: Data theory, a branch of discrete mathematics, plays a crucial role in recommendation systems in addition visit the website to social network analysis. Algorithms similar to PageRank, based on graph explanation, are at the heart of seo.
Challenges and Future Directions
While the marriage of carried out mathematics and machine studying has resulted in remarkable work, several challenges persist:
Interpretable Models: As machine studying models grow in complexity, the exact interpretability of their results becomes a concern. There is a need for numerical techniques to make models much more transparent and interpretable.
Data Privacy and Ethics: The very mathematical algorithms behind equipment learning also raise difficulties related to data privacy, tendency, and ethics. Applied math must address these considerations to ensure fair and meaning AI.
Scalability: As data volumes continue to grow, scalability remains a mathematical concern. Developing algorithms that can resourcefully handle massive datasets can be an ongoing area of research.
Applied mathematics and product learning are deeply connected, with mathematics providing the know how and techniques that desire the development and improvement regarding machine learning algorithms. Coming from linear algebra to optimisation and probability theory, math concepts are the underpinning that is sophisticated AI applications.
Simply because machine learning continues to progress, so does the role connected with applied mathematics in developing the field. New mathematical inventions will further enhance the efficiency, interpretability, and ethical concern of machine learning codes, making them even more powerful as well as reliable tools for approaching complex real-world challenges.